Role of Natural Gas Consumption in the Reduction of CO<sub>2</sub> Emissions: Case of Azerbaijan
Azerbaijan signed the Paris Agreement in 2016 and committed to cut gre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ions by 35% in 2030. Meanwhile, natural gas has been vital component in the total energy mix of Azerbaijan economy and accounted for almost 65% of the total energy consumption. In the overall electricity mix...
